The Raba H18 is a 6x6 military heavy utility truck. It's development began in the mid 1980s. The first prototype of this truck was based on the Soviet KamAZ 6x6 truck. The H18 entered service with Hungarian Army in 2004. Vehicle complies with NATO standards.
The Raba H18 is completed with a MAN cab. Vehicle can be fitted with various bodies, that have a modular design. This military truck has a payload capacity of up to 10 t, depending on road conditions. It can tow artillery pieces or trailers.
Vehicle is powered by a MAN turbocharged diesel engine, developing 280 hp. The same engine is used on other Raba military trucks. Vehicles used by Hungarian Army are fitted with speed limiters, set at 85 km/h. Vehicle is fitted with a central tyre inflation system. These military trucks have a planned service life of 20 years.
